The Hotel



An old-fashioned hotel with a modern touch. The name of the hotel has been worn away by time, but the rest of it looks almost brand new.

Upon entering the hotel you're greeted with an old-fashioned check-in desk. To your left, the rooms there have been combined into one big one, with beds on one side, bunk beds on the other, and an area in the middle to mingle and relax.

To your right, a dining area and the kitchen. The kitchen has basic appliances, such as a microwave and a coffee maker.

Also to your right are the bathrooms. The showers have frosted over doors to allow for some privacy, and past those and the toilets is a large, communal bath.

Located south of Domed City Park.

(details)


The check-in desk. At any point an NPC can be found hanging out there.

Behind the desk are rows of keys, though none of them can be taken at this time. You can find paper, pens, pencils and such if you search through the drawers; it's always replenished. An old rotary phone also sits on the desk, but trying to make a call just gets you a busy signal.

The doors to either side lead to the Iotomes Wellness Center and Spa.



Stepping into the large communal living area, there are single beds lined up against the wall, spaced enough to give people some space. There are enough beds for everyone despite how the room looks much larger than it should be if one were to look at the hotel from the outside.

Each bed has a little nightstand next to it, with a drawer and a dim lamp on top.



The other side of the room has a similar set-up, but instead of single beds there are bunkbeds. Each one has a little shelf on the head of the bed with a little drawer there as well as a dim lamp.



In the center of the room is a living area, with plenty of comfortable couches and chairs to sit in. Against the wall closest to the exits are shelves of books, both from this world and others. Perhaps even yours.



The kitchen has the basic necessities, like a stove, a fridge, and a sink, as well as appliances such as a microwave and a coffee maker.

The cabinets shelves are stocked with basic foods, spices, and condiments. But to make anything worthwhile, you probably need to give the supermarket a visit.



The dining area has enough seating for everyone, though it seems to shrink and grow depending on necessity. There are always clean plates and glasses available.




The bathrooms each have a private door with a lock so one can't be bothered in their most vulnerable moment.

The shower doors are frosted glass in order to provide some manner of privacy. There is a shelf just out of the water where someone can put their clothes so you can get in changed in there.

At the back of the bathroom is a large, communal bath. There are a few little showering spots nearby for people to clean off before entering. The water is always warm.

Towels, shampoo, and toilet paper are provided.



The Iontomes Wellness Center and Spa




Through the doors behind the reception desk in the Hotel is a decently sized room dedicated to the health and wellness of the Hotel's patrons. Here is where you can rest, relax, and help each other heal from those grave injuries you'll surely get in the Ceremonies!

(details)


There's a juice bar full of all sorts of delicious-looking drinks of all different colors, a row of massage chairs that will work out every kink in your muscles and then some, and a few tables and comfortable-looking chairs to lounge in and relax.

But the centerpiece of the room is the large pool in the center. While the room itself is oddly pristine, the pool looks as though it's seen a lot of use over the years. Vines dangle and curl around the pillars around it, with little bushels of flowers growing at the bottom. The water is a faint, glowing blue-green and the smell is familiar to you, something on the tip of your tongue and buried in your memories, but comforting.

Above the pool on the wall is a sign written in delicate, flowing script:

The bonds you share are stronger than you will ever know.


At the front of it all is another, small reception desk but as of right now, no one is sat behind it.

The Hospital



While it's called the hospital, it's more like an urgent care building. When you step inside there's a small lobby, and past that is a large room with a number of hospital beds set up. A few have been obviously slept in, while one has a suspicious stain on it.

Located south of Domed City Park and across the street from the hotel.

(details)


There are no IV racks or machines to indicate that it ever was an actual hospital, and besides the beds it is always clean.

To the left of the lobby are a set of stairs leading to the second floor. Here, there are a number of small offices as well as a decently sized storage room. However, you can only find bandages and medicine here. It restocks every couple of days.

Domed City #77 Central Park



The "center" of the Domed City, the park is a large, circular park that someone put a great deal of care into creating. The grass is perfectly manicured, the bushes and flowers and other plant life are carefully kept. No matter the weather outside of the park's bounds, the weather is always warm and pleasant.

In the center is a large fountain. Occasionally you can find ducks and geese wandering around it, bathing in the water. And as the sun sets the lights on top turn on, shining bright to light the entire area.

(details)

The circle on the outside is a street, acting as a roundabout to the other main streets of the city. Even here the care that went into making this park can be seen, with perfectly painted crosswalks and curb lines, grates for rain strategically placed so that the road never floods.

Along the other walkways are plenty of seating, comfortable metal benches that shine in the sun, swinging benches here and there that only creak a tiny bit when you swing on them. A garbage can is never far, in an effort to keep the area clean.

Stepping off the walkways into the grass, there's tables and benches set up, as though someone were preparing for a cookout. In another area, a blanket has been set out for a picnic.

One area is dedicated to a smaller kids park, with swings and a slide and monkey bars. Oddly, and maybe hilariously, they are built slightly bigger to accommodate bigger adults.

And of course, there's squirrels and chipmunks and birds, chirping and skittering around as animals do. Occasionally a deer may wander from out of nowhere to nibble on the bushes.

But what's odd about that is, you will never see these animals outside of the park. Huh.



The fountain in the center is no different from the rest, intricately detailed and crafted to be something people want to see, rather than merely a monument. The water is always bright and crystal clear, even with the wildlife swimming and bathing in it, and there is never a spot of dirt on it. The lights on top seem small, but at night are fully capable of lighting the entire center of the park without being too bright to look at.

Best of all, it's always peaceful. Even the ambience seems a little muted if you pay attention, as though even the volume has softened to the perfect pitch.



Police Station



Across the street from the Supermarket is the police station. It's surprisingly small for a city and honestly easy to miss due to it looking like any of the other buildings in the area. The only thing distinguishing it is the two cop cars parked out front.

But unlike other buildings, whatever has been keeping everything clean has completely passed over the station. The bushes around the perimeter are overgrown, grown too high to see over them. The pavement is uneven as flora breaks through and the lines that once denoted parking spots are cracked and nearly faded. And the cop cars parked out front - they've been sat there a long time, tires flat and rust starting to crawl up from under the wheel wells.

The Library



While many buildings in the city look almost new, the library looks as though it's been sitting here for years. While still kept clean, the sidewalk leading up to the door is cracked and faded from hundreds of thousands of people walking on it and the bushes around it are slightly overgrown. It's almost like someone's forgotten to come by to keep it tidy like the other places in the city.
